One of Nigeria’s most exciting attackers in Europe has been tipped to take the Spanish First Division by storm in the coming campaign

Super Eagles and Almeria forward Umar Sadiq is a fantastic footballer whose level is beyond the Spanish Segunda Division, says respected football pundit Julius ‘Maldini’ Maldonado.

Maldini has been left in awe by the consistent, match-winning performances of Sadiq for Almeria since the striker joined from Partizan Belgrade in 2020.

After smashing 20 goals while providing seven assists in 38 league games in his debut campaign in the second-tier of the Spanish league football system, Sadiq has refused to take his foot off the accelerator.

Despite spending a few weeks in January with the Nigerian national team at the African Cup of Nations in Cameroon, Sadiq has contributed more goals than any other in the Segunda Division.

The 25-year-old has had a hand in 24 goals (13 goals, nine assists) in 26 league games for La Union. He has another goal in two Copa del Rey matches as well.

Aside from his many goals and assists, Sadiq’s physical attributes and his brilliant link-up play have convinced international football analyst Maldini that the Nigerian was specially built for the Spanish La Liga.

“He is a tremendous footballer,” the 54-year-old said of the Nigerian international, as per Estadio Deportivo.

“He has a lot of power and is able to take out defenders with sheer power. In addition, he is capable of scoring goals with good definitions.

“It is clear that he is a player who is not from the Second Division. Next year yes, he will play in La Liga; we will see if we see him with Almería, if they finally get promoted, or with another team.”

Sadiq scored a brace at the weekend as Almeria drew 3-3 at home to Lugo to remain second on the Segunda table.

The Rojiblancos will be promoted to the elite division if they win their remaining matches.
